基于ABAQUS的标准拉伸试样仿真校核研究

摘  要:针对材料试验机检定校准费时费力问题,利用ABAQUS软件对标准拉伸试样模型进行模拟仿真拉伸试验,获得模型在计算机软件中模拟的应力—应变曲线,与标准拉伸试样在实验室材料试验机实际拉伸试验曲线进行对比分析,分析结果表明:该模拟仿真试验对提高材料试验机的试验数据准确度和复现性具有一定的指导意义,但不能完全取代材料试验机的定期检定校准工作。In view of the time-consuming and laborious problem of verification and calibration of material testing machines,ABAQUS software was used to carry out simulated tensile tests on the standard tensile specimen model,and the stress-strain curve simulated by the model in the computer software was obtained,which was compared with the actual tensile test curve of the standard tensile specimen on the laboratory material testing machine.The analysis results show that the simulation test has certain guiding significance for improving the accuracy and reproducibility of test data of the material testing machine,but it cannot completely replace the regular verification and calibration work of the material testing machine.
